About This Item
With dust jacket. Red cloth boards with gilt titles and pictorial design on spine; gilt design on front. Test block with black edge on top. With b&w and colour illustrations. Contains a pictorial book mark.
Dust jacket rubbed around the edges and with a few small closed tears; paper browned. Boards mildly rubbed on edges. Pages browned but otherwise clean; text block bumped on upper edge but only affecting about 10 pages. Binding firm.
